How to fill out a personal financial statement?

01
Gather all necessary financial documents such as bank statements, investment account statements, credit card statements, loan documents, and tax returns.
02
Start by filling out the personal information section which typically includes your name, contact information, social security number, and date of birth.
03
Provide an overview of your assets by listing the current value of your bank accounts, investment accounts, real estate properties, vehicles, and any other valuable possessions.
04
Detail your liabilities by including outstanding balances on mortgages, loans, credit cards, and any other debts you may have.
05
Provide a breakdown of your income sources, including your salary, commissions, bonuses, rental income, investment income, and any other sources of regular income.
06
Deduct your monthly expenses, such as mortgage or rent payments, utilities, insurance premiums, transportation costs, food expenses, and any other regular bills you have.
07
Calculate the difference between your total income and total expenses to determine your monthly cash flow.
08
Include additional information such as personal guarantees, life insurance policies, and any co-signed loans.

Who needs a personal financial statement?

01
Individuals applying for loans: When applying for a mortgage, car loan, or any other type of loan, lenders often require a personal financial statement to assess your financial stability and repayment ability.
02
Small business owners: Business owners may need to submit a personal financial statement when applying for business loans or seeking investment capital. This allows lenders or investors to evaluate the owner's personal financial situation along with the business's financial health.
03
High-net-worth individuals: Wealthy individuals may use personal financial statements to track their assets, liabilities, and net worth for estate planning, financial management, or evaluation of investment portfolios.
04
Divorcing couples: During divorce proceedings, both parties may be required to complete a personal financial statement to provide a comprehensive overview of their financial situation for equitable distribution of assets and liabilities.
05
Job applicants in certain industries: Some job positions, mainly in the finance or accounting sectors, may require candidates to submit a personal financial statement as part of the application process. This helps employers assess the candidate's financial responsibility and trustworthiness.
Overall, a personal financial statement is a valuable tool for individuals to track their financial health, apply for loans, seek investments, and provide a snapshot of their financial situation to relevant parties.

A personal financial statement is a document that outlines an individual's financial situation at a specific point in time.
Certain individuals such as government officials, candidates running for office, and executives of publicly traded companies are often required to file personal financial statements.
Personal financial statements can be filled out by listing assets, liabilities, income, and expenses. It is important to be thorough and accurate when filling out the document.
The purpose of a personal financial statement is to provide a snapshot of an individual's financial health and to disclose any potential conflicts of interest.
Information such as bank account balances, investment holdings, real estate properties, and outstanding loans must be reported on a personal financial statement.
